Manatee River Holiday Boat Parade Returns Dec. 14

BRADENTON – The Bradenton Yacht Club will once again host the 16th Annual Holiday Boat Parade on Saturday, December 14. The annual event features boats of all shapes and sizes, decorated with Christmas lights and themes to celebrate the season. Spectators can witness the boats from either side of the river.

Boats will stage in the river near Desoto Park, where they light up for a Christmas spectacular. They will proceed to the Bradenton Yacht Club, which is open to the public for this event. After dazzling spectators and judges there, they line back up and pass by the Regatta Pointe Marina (1005 Riverside Drive, Palmetto) before heading over to the Twin Dolphin Marina (1000 1st Ave West, Bradenton) for their final showing.

Some boats that are small enough will pass under the bridges then travel east to pass in front of Tarpon Pointe Marina before circling back. There are a number of restaurants along the path from which to view the parade.

Categories and Prizes:
 
40 feet and over
31-39 feet
30 feet and under
Corporate (all sizes)   

1st place: $250
2nd place: $100
3rd place: $50
(Corporate entries will qualify for gift cards)

A public award ceremony will be held immediately following the parade at the Bradenton Yacht Club.
